## PR: Backpressure for Hollerbeam notification fan-out

Fan-out workers currently pull unbounded batches, so a burst from the Ketterly campaign service can starve everything else. This PR adds a bounded queue per channel, sheds load once depth crosses the high-water mark, and slows producers via a token bucket. Degrades gracefully: digest-class notifications drop first, transactional last. If paged, check queue depth before touching anything. The knobs are defined below.

tuning table, kajog-bawip:
TIERS = {
    "kelius": 256,
    "lammir": 543,
}

Flaky integration tests in Tollgate payments service. Root cause: the mock settlement clock drifts when suites run in parallel. Workaround: pin the fixture clock in setup, never rely on wall time. Retries mask it but waste CI minutes. If a failure reproduces twice, grab artifacts before the runner recycles. The last known-good build is recorded below.

session token of tajef-bageg = htk21_5d90d574934f3ccae6437

// MAX_GC_PAUSE_BUDGET_MS bounds acceptable stop-the-world pauses in the
// Pairlight matching service. Pauses above this budget cause match offers
// to expire before dispatch, which we observed twice during the Holloway
// capacity trials. Do not raise this without re-running the latency suite.
// The value was tuned against the build whose token appears below.

pipeline stamp: htk3_cc5